1. the largest area Tony can get is if the rectangular is a square. You know what the perimeter of the square is which is the total length of the fence so you can work out the dimension of the square.

2. the circumference of the circle is also the total length of the fence so you can work out the radius of the circle and from that work out the area of the circle. You can then compare the area of the square and the circle and see which has a bigger area.
